Fall mowing services focus on maintaining lawns during the autumn months, ensuring grass is kept at an appropriate height as the growing season winds down. These services typically involve trimming and mowing grass to prevent overgrowth and to prepare the yard for winter. Contractors may also include edging along sidewalks, driveways, and flower beds to create a clean, well-kept appearance. Regular fall mowing helps to manage the remaining grass growth and reduces the accumulation of leaves and debris that can clutter the lawn.

One of the key problems addressed by fall mowing services is the prevention of lawn damage caused by overgrown grass. When grass is allowed to grow too tall, it can become prone to disease, pest infestation, and winter kill. Additionally, excessive thatch buildup can hinder proper nutrient absorption and water penetration. Fall mowing helps mitigate these issues by promoting healthier turf, reducing the risk of fungal infections, and making it easier to remove fallen leaves and organic matter that can smother the grass.

Average Cost Range - Fall mowing services typically cost between $50 and $150 per visit, depending on lawn size and complexity. For example, a standard residential yard might fall within the $75 to $100 range. Costs can vary based on local market rates and service provider pricing.

Factors Affecting Pricing - The overall cost is influenced by lawn size, terrain, and whether additional services like trimming are included. Larger or more challenging properties may incur higher fees, sometimes exceeding $200 per session.

Per Acre or Square Foot Rates - Some providers charge by acreage, with rates often ranging from $100 to $250 per acre. For smaller areas, pricing might be calculated per square foot, typically around $0.02 to $0.05 per sq ft.

Service Frequency and Cost - Fall mowing is usually performed once or twice during the season, with costs adjusted accordingly. The total expense depends on how many visits are needed to maintain the lawn's appearance through fall months.

When is the best time to mow in the fall? Fall mowing is typically recommended when grass growth slows but before winter dormancy begins, usually in early to mid-fall, depending on local climate conditions.

How often should I schedule fall mowing services? The frequency of fall mowing depends on grass type and growth rate, but many providers suggest mowing every 2 to 4 weeks during the fall season.

What are the benefits of fall mowing? Fall mowing can help maintain lawn health, prevent pest and disease issues, and prepare the grass for winter dormancy by removing excess growth.

Are there any precautions to consider for fall mowing? It’s advisable to avoid mowing when the lawn is wet and to set mower blades to a higher setting to prevent stressing the grass during cooler months.
